Position Title: Program Manager  Job Family: Program Management Location: Onsite - Clearwater, FL     McCormick Stevenson, subsidiary of Paligen Technologies, is adding a Program Manager to the team. The Program Manager will perform day-to-day management of overall contract support operations, possibly involving multiple projects. Establish and maintain client relationships on assigned programs. Organize, direct, and coordinate planning and production of all contract support activities. Maintain organizational standards of customer satisfaction, quality, and performance. Strategize, implement, and maintain program initiatives that adhere to organizational objectives. Manage project budget and internal funding sources for maximum productivity. Responsibilities: * Work closely with clients, internal teams and vendors to plan and develop scope, deliverables, required resources, work plans, budgets, and timing for project tasks. * Develop program assessment protocols for evaluation and improvement. * Oversee multiple project teams, ensuring program goals are achieved. * Manage the development and delivery of the response to Requests for Proposals (RFPs), including developing cost, manpower estimates and coordinating technical inputs. * Develop and manage the budget for projects and be accountable for delivering against established business goals/objectives. * Work with other program/project managers to identify risks and opportunities across multiple projects within * the organization. * Build the McCormick Stevenson brand through customer focus, performance, and successful completion of programs on schedule and within budget. * Analyze, evaluate and overcome program risks, produce program reports for management and stakeholders. * Monitor program performance including related tasks, activities and deliverables.   Qualifications: * BS degree in engineering or related field with a minimum of 5 yrs relevant experience or equivalent combination of experience and education. * Experience managing large and complex programs or projects. * Minimum of 3 years Program Management experience in a DoD and national security environment. * Experience managing the development of successful proposals in the DoD and national security industries. * Demonstrated experience leading proposal development tasks. * Exceptional leadership, time management, facilitation, and organizational skills. * Exceptional interpersonal and communication skills. * Knowledge of cost accounting and US Government FARs. * Fundamental knowledge of project and program management methodologies. * Understand the wider objectives of the program, such as business and strategic goals. * Ability to work with a wide range of individuals. * Strong knowledge of budgeting and resource allocation procedures. * Must have the ability to obtain a Secret DoD clearance.   Preferred: * Master’s degree in business administration or related field. * Direct experience managing DoD prime contracts. * PMP Certification. * Strong working knowledge of CRM software.
